Text to PDF

Convert a plain text file to a clean, shareable PDF.

Upload a .txt file and get a neatly formatted PDF with proper page breaks and margins.

Converting plain text to PDF gives your content a professional, printable format with consistent margins and typography. The output uses Helvetica at 12pt on standard letter-sized pages with comfortable margins.

Long lines are automatically word-wrapped to fit within the page margins, so even text files without soft wrapping display cleanly. Page breaks are inserted automatically when text fills a page.

This is useful for sharing notes, scripts, code snippets, or any text content in a universally readable format that looks consistent on all devices and can be opened in any PDF reader.
